no > Feb 4 16:35:56 kernel: lowmem_reserve[]: 0 0 0 0 > Feb 4 16:35:56 kernel: DMA: 2*4kB 4*8kB 2*16kB 1*32kB 0*64kB 1*128kB 1*256kB 0*512kB 1*1024kB 1*2048kB 0*4096kB = 3560kB > Feb 4 16:35:56 kernel: Normal: 75*4kB 10*8kB 21*16kB 4*32kB 3*64kB 1*128kB 1*256kB 1*512kB 0*1024kB 1*2048kB 0*4096kB = 3980kB > Feb 4 16:35:56 kernel: HighMem: 1036*4kB 2516*8kB 1914*16kB 1571*32kB 1176*64kB 785*128kB 533*256kB 336*512kB 230*1024kB 148*2048kB 1527*4096kB = 7382608kB > Feb 4 16:35:56 kernel: Swap cache: add 0, delete 0, find 0/0, race 0+0 > Feb 4 16:35:56 kernel: Free swap = 16777208kB > Feb 4 16:35:56 kernel: Total swap = 16777208kB > Feb 4 16:35:56 kernel: Free swap: 16777208kB > Feb 4 16:35:56 kernel: 2490368 pages of RAM > Feb 4 16:35:56 kernel: 2260992 pages of HIGHMEM > Feb 4 16:35:56 kernel: 415332 reserved pages > Feb 4 16:35:56 kernel: 25392 pages shared > Feb 4 16:35:56 kernel: 0 pages swap cached > Feb 4 16:35:56 kernel: 0 pages dirty > Feb 4 16:35:56 kernel: 0 pages writeback > Feb 4 16:35:56 kernel: 3787 pages mapped > Feb 4 16:35:56 kernel: 4426 pages slab > Feb 4 16:35:56 kernel: 360 pages pagetables > Looks like quicklists again. Can you try patching your kernel with the following patch. It should be there in the next stable release. commit 96990a4ae979df9e235d01097d6175759331e88c Author: Christoph Lameter Date: Mon Jan 14 00:55:14 2008 -0800 quicklists: Only consider memory that can be used with GFP_KERNEL Quicklists calculates the size of the quicklists based on the number of free pages. This must be the number of free pages that can be allocated with GFP_KERNEL. node_page_state() includes the pages in ZONE_HIGHMEM and ZONE_MOVABLE which may lead the quicklists to become too large causing OOM.
